黑狐家游戏

深入剖析,PHP + MySQL 构建企业网站源码全解析,php+mysql网站开发项目式教程 源码

欧气 0 0

本文目录导读:

深入剖析,PHP + MySQL 构建企业网站源码全解析,php+mysql网站开发项目式教程 源码

图片来源于网络,如有侵权联系删除

  1. PHP + MySQL 企业网站源码架构
  2. 源码解析

随着互联网的快速发展,企业网站已经成为企业展示形象、拓展市场、提升竞争力的重要平台,PHP作为一款功能强大的开源服务器端脚本语言,与MySQL数据库的结合,为企业网站的开发提供了强大的动力,本文将从源码角度,深入剖析PHP + MySQL企业网站源码的构建过程,为广大开发者提供参考。

PHP + MySQL 企业网站源码架构

1、系统架构

PHP + MySQL 企业网站源码通常采用B/S(Browser/Server)架构,即浏览器/服务器架构,浏览器负责前端展示,服务器负责处理业务逻辑和数据存储。

2、技术选型

(1)前端:HTML5、CSS3、JavaScript、jQuery、Bootstrap等

(2)后端:PHP、MySQL、Redis、Memcached等

(3)框架:ThinkPHP、Laravel、CodeIgniter等

3、模块划分

(1)首页:展示企业最新动态、产品信息、联系方式等

(2)产品中心:展示企业产品,包括产品详情、分类、搜索等

(3)新闻中心:发布企业新闻,包括新闻列表、详情、分类等

(4)关于我们:介绍企业背景、发展历程、企业文化等

(5)联系方式:展示企业联系方式,包括电话、邮箱、地址等

源码解析

1、数据库设计

(1)数据库结构

数据库采用MySQL数据库,主要包括以下表:

- 用户表(user):存储用户信息,包括用户名、密码、邮箱、手机号等

深入剖析,PHP + MySQL 构建企业网站源码全解析,php+mysql网站开发项目式教程 源码

图片来源于网络,如有侵权联系删除

- 产品表(product):存储产品信息,包括产品名称、描述、图片、价格等

- 新闻表(news):存储新闻信息,包括标题、内容、发布时间、分类等

- 分类表(category):存储分类信息,包括分类名称、父级分类等

(2)数据关系

- 用户表与产品表:一对多关系,一个用户可以拥有多个产品

- 用户表与新闻表:一对多关系,一个用户可以发布多个新闻

- 产品表与分类表:一对多关系,一个产品属于一个分类

2、业务逻辑实现

(1)首页

首页展示企业最新动态、产品信息、联系方式等,主要涉及以下功能:

- 获取最新动态:查询数据库中最新发布的新闻

- 获取热门产品:查询数据库中浏览量最高的产品

- 展示联系方式:调用数据库中存储的企业联系方式

(2)产品中心

产品中心展示企业产品,包括产品详情、分类、搜索等,主要涉及以下功能:

- 获取产品列表:查询数据库中所有产品信息

- 获取产品详情:查询数据库中指定产品信息

深入剖析,PHP + MySQL 构建企业网站源码全解析,php+mysql网站开发项目式教程 源码

图片来源于网络,如有侵权联系删除

- 按分类查询:根据分类ID查询对应分类下的产品

- 搜索产品:根据关键词查询产品

(3)新闻中心

新闻中心发布企业新闻,包括新闻列表、详情、分类等,主要涉及以下功能:

- 获取新闻列表:查询数据库中所有新闻信息

- 获取新闻详情:查询数据库中指定新闻信息

- 按分类查询:根据分类ID查询对应分类下的新闻

3、数据库交互

(1)查询数据库

- 使用PHP的PDO或mysqli扩展与MySQL数据库进行交互

- 编写SQL语句,根据需求查询数据库中的数据

(2)更新数据库

- 使用PHP的PDO或mysqli扩展与MySQL数据库进行交互

- 编写SQL语句,根据需求更新数据库中的数据

本文从源码角度,深入剖析了PHP + MySQL企业网站源码的构建过程,通过了解系统架构、技术选型、模块划分、数据库设计、业务逻辑实现和数据库交互等方面的内容,可以帮助开发者更好地理解企业网站源码的构建过程,为实际开发提供参考,在实际开发过程中,开发者可以根据自身需求,对源码进行修改和优化,以提升企业网站的性能和用户体验。

标签: #php mysql 企业网站源码

黑狐家游戏
  • 评论列表

留言评论